Output ec80bd6c20f986ac63bfc232d698d5d9b6a70ed75aa92e83ee2d15a770e5d0df:0

value
480078805
script pubkey
OP_0 OP_PUSHBYTES_20 bd486265b27818b11220ca1e76e683a5e30f8ba9
address
bc1qh4yxyedj0qvtzy3qeg08de5r5h3slzafqr0l2k
transaction
ec80bd6c20f986ac63bfc232d698d5d9b6a70ed75aa92e83ee2d15a770e5d0df
confirmations
2172
spent
true